Rainy Season in Osaka: Simple Pest Control Tips for New Residents

Moving to Osaka is an exciting experience, especially for those arriving to work, study, or start a new chapter in Japan. As the rainy season (tsuyu) begins, however, many newcomers are surprised to find that increased humidity and rainfall can also bring unwanted household pests.

The warm, damp conditions of early summer create an ideal environment for insects such as cockroaches, mosquitoes, ants, and silverfish. Fortunately, a few simple precautions can help keep your apartment comfortable and pest-free throughout the season.

One of the most effective measures is controlling moisture. Pests thrive in humid environments, so use your air conditioner’s dry mode or a dehumidifier whenever possible. Ensure that bathrooms and kitchens are well ventilated, and avoid leaving wet towels or damp clothing indoors for extended periods.

Food storage is another important factor. Even small crumbs or unsealed food containers can attract insects. Store dry foods in sealed containers, wipe kitchen surfaces regularly, and dispose of rubbish frequently, especially during the warmer months.

Check windows, doors, and balconies for small gaps where insects may enter. Many apartments in Osaka are equipped with screens, but it is worth inspecting them for tears or damage. Keeping balcony areas tidy and free of standing water can also help reduce mosquito activity.

For residents who are new to Japan, local home centres and drugstores offer a wide range of affordable pest-control products, including insect sprays, traps, and mosquito repellents. These products are widely used and can provide additional protection during the peak rainy season.

If you notice signs of a larger pest problem, it is advisable to contact your property manager promptly. Early intervention can prevent a minor issue from becoming a more significant concern.
